We report herein the case of a 35-year-old woman with aplastic anemia who developed hepatocellular carcinoma after long-term therapy with oxymetholone. She was treated with 60 mg/day of oxymetholone for 3 years (total dose 64.8 g). Alpha-fetoprotein, hepatitis B surface antigen, and hepatitis C antibody were all negative, but serum titers of carcinoembryonic antigen and carbohydrate antigen were elevated. Lateral segmentectomy of the liver was performed. The histopathological findings were compatible with those of multiple hepatocellular carcinoma without liver cirrhosis. Three years since the operation, the patient is doing well and no signs of tumor recurrence have been detected. According to our review of Japanese cases of hepatocellular carcinoma associated with anabolic steroid therapy, in all instances the tumors developed after long-term administration of anabolic steroids for hematologic diseases. In patients under long-term anabolic steroid therapy, routine screening of the liver by ultrasonography and computed tomography should be performed to detect liver tumors in the early stages.


Medline Abstract.

17aa oral steroid oxymethalone (Anadrol) Can cause hepatocellular carcinoma (liver cancer).

Pay close attention to the duration of use though, 3 years.

In the rare cases of cancer associated with androgen use, most if not all seem to be situations in which a patient usess the drug for a long period of time (several years) to treat a variety of conditions such as aplasic anemia or other blood disorders. There is no real evidence of the effects of a typical 6 weeks of use by bodybuilders because studies are few and far between when it comes to steroid for cosmetic use.

However, i have read several studies that state the hepatic toxcicity of steroids is overexagerated and missunderstood.
